Honey Ginger Pickles
Honey Ginger Pickles are a wonderful addition to meals, providing a unique balance of sweet and sour flavors that enliven every dish. You can easily make these at home using a touch of natural honey for a mild sweetness that enhances soups and sauces. Making ginger pickles from scratch is both fun and healthier than buying them from the store.
Ginger is revered globally for its culinary and medicinal uses. It is one of the oldest natural remedies, prized for treating upset stomachs, respiratory issues, bloating, gas, acidity, and even skin problems. Its potent, pungent nature offers anti-inflammatory and antibacterial benefits, aids digestion, and supports gut microbial balance. A staple in Ayurvedic and Chinese medicine, ginger also helps stabilize Helicobacter pylori, which when overgrown, can lead to ulcers.
Natural honey, another home essential, brims with antioxidants including flavonoids and organic acids that combat free radicals and oxidative damage. Additionally, honey helps lower triglycerides, blood pressure, and bad cholesterol levels, promoting heart health. When applied topically, it accelerates wound healing and rejuvenates skin cells through cellular regeneration.
